Stories Our Buildings Tell – Volume Two Book Launch

On February 6 and 7, 2026, Heritage Winnipeg celebrated the successful launch of “Winnipeg: Stories Our Buildings Tell” Volume Two at Indigo St. Vital. The event provided opportunity for attendees to meet and chat with the authors, have their books signed, and honour the heritage buildings that have helped shape our city.

Volume Two features 120 pages of original artwork by local artist Robert Sweeney, showcasing Winnipeg’s rich architectural history. Each illustration is accompanied by the fascinating stories behind these buildings written by Robert Sweeney and Heritage Winnipeg’s President, Greg Agnew.

The second volume is now available at all three Indigo locations, alongside the first volume. The first volume can also be purchased at both McNally Robinson locations.

Heritage Winnipeg would like to thank everyone who attended the book launch and supported the release of Volume Two. Copies are available in both paperback and hardcover editions. All proceeds from book sales support Heritage Winnipeg’s ongoing efforts to conserve and celebrate Winnipeg’s built heritage.
